在数字化时代,代码与艺术的交织已经成为一种全新的创作方式。当代码遇见艺术,不仅是一场视觉的盛宴,更是一次思想与技术的碰撞。本文将深入探讨代码与艺术的融合,揭示这种跨界合作的无限可能。

一、代码的艺术表达

代码,作为计算机语言的载体,原本是为了解决问题而存在。然而,当它遇见艺术,便成为了一种全新的表达方式。通过编程,艺术家可以将抽象的思维具象化,创造出独特的视觉作品。

1. 数字绘画:艺术家利用编程语言,如Processing、Python等,创作出具有独特风格的数字绘画。这些作品在色彩、构图、线条等方面,展现出与传统绘画不同的美感。

2. 动态艺术:利用编程技术,艺术家可以将静态的图像转化为动态的视觉效果。例如,通过调整参数,使图像产生旋转、缩放、变形等效果,从而呈现出独特的动态美感。

二、艺术与代码的跨界合作

在艺术与代码的跨界合作中,艺术家与程序员共同探索,创造出许多令人惊叹的作品。以下是一些典型的例子:

1. 人工智能艺术:通过深度学习、神经网络等技术,人工智能可以创作出具有独特风格的画作。艺术家与程序员合作,将人工智能的艺术创作与人类的艺术理念相结合,创造出全新的艺术形式。

2. 交互式艺术:利用编程技术,艺术家可以创作出与观众互动的艺术作品。观众可以通过触摸、声音等方式与作品产生互动,从而获得独特的艺术体验。

三、代码与艺术的未来

随着科技的不断发展,代码与艺术的融合将更加深入。以下是一些未来发展趋势:

1. 虚拟现实艺术:虚拟现实技术为艺术家提供了全新的创作空间。通过编程,艺术家可以创作出沉浸式的虚拟现实艺术作品,让观众在虚拟世界中感受艺术的魅力。

2. 区块链艺术:区块链技术为艺术品的创作、传播、交易提供了全新的可能性。艺术家可以利用区块链技术,创作出具有唯一性的数字艺术品,并通过去中心化的方式进行交易。

当代码遇见艺术,不仅是一次视觉的盛宴,更是一次思想与技术的碰撞。在这个数字化时代,代码与艺术的融合将为艺术创作带来无限可能。未来,随着科技的不断发展,这种跨界合作将更加深入,为人们带来更多精彩的艺术体验。